447. To ask the Minister for Foreign Affairs and Trade the number of meetings of heads of mission that have taken place in the past ten years; when the next heads of mission meeting is scheduled for; its strategic goals; and if he will make a statement on the matter. [43230/14]

Since 2004, the Department has organised two formal Heads of Mission conferences, one in 2009 and the other in 2011. The next Heads of Mission conference will take place in Dublin from 12 – 14 January 2015. While the programme for the conference has yet to be fully finalised, the conference will provide an opportunity to coordinate the work of Ireland’s diplomatic network in advancing key Government priorities and in providing a first-rate service to Irish citizens and businesses. The Deputy will also wish to note that officials at Headquarters regularly meet with Heads of Mission on an individual and regional basis to discuss issues and to set strategic priorities for their respective missions.
